Your program Assignment Write a program that reads a sentence as input and converts each word to "Pig Latin". In one version of
xxTIMURxx [149]

Answer:

theSentence = input('Enter sentence: ')

theSentence = theSentence.split()

sentence_split_list =[]

for word in theSentence:

  sentence_split_list.append(word[1:]+word[0]+'ay')

sentence_split_list = ' '.join(sentence_split_list)

print(sentence_split_list)

Explanation:

Using the input function in python Programming language, the user is prompted to enter a sentence. The sentence is splited and and a new list is created with this statements;

theSentence = theSentence.split()

sentence_split_list =[ ]

In this way every word in the sentence becomes an element in this list and individual operations can be carried out on them

Using the append method and list slicing in the for loop, every word in the sentence is converted to a PIG LATIN
